摘要
In HLA Class II genes, polymorphism is mainly located in the second exon, Most DNA based typing methods are confined to the identification of specific sequence motifs in the second exon. In contrast, Sequencing Based Typing (SBT) elucidates the entire exon 2 sequence for typing. Comparison of the obtained exon 2 sequence with an allele sequence library results in allele assignment. We tested the applicability of SET using a protocol for amplification followed by solid phase Tag-cycle sequencing for HLA-DPB 1 typing. A panel of 32 samples were typed by SBT at live test sites which are participating in the Sequencing Based Typing component of the 12th International Histocompatibility Workshop. The panel represents the existing polymorphism at all known polymorphic positions of exon 2, both in homozygous and heterozygous combinations. In this multicenter study we focused on the reliability of analyzing heterozygous sequences for HLA typing. A multi-sequence analysis approach, Polall, was developed to evaluate sequences obtained. The assignment of homozygosity and heterozygosity was validated by cluster analysis of chromatographic data of all sequences. Sequence characteristics were examined and considered for appropriate assignment. Differences in sequence characteristics that occurred between the test sites are considered in detail. The evaluation of data of 5 test sites reveals that Tag-cycle sequencing can reliably be performed for HLA-DPB1 SBT.
